> Here are the three errors I most commonly see in IDL programs.

> 1. IDL programs are named incorrectly. The last program
>    module in the file should have the same name as the file.
>    Utility modules in the file should start with the name
>    of the "command" (or last) module to make clear their
>    purpose.

> 2. KEYWORD_SET is used to check whether a keyword is
>    "used" or "defined". This function should only be
>    used with binary keywords. (I plan to avoid all
>    nuance with this list, and just go with black and
>    white pronouncements.)

> 3. People draw graphics willy-nilly in widget programs
>    without having the faintest idea which window their
>    graphics might show up in.

How about:
-indexing for-loops with (short) integers.
-using indeces from where without checking count > 0
